So, Metallica's been around for 30 years. Feel old now? 30 years of metal up your ass. The Mighty Mets decided to throw down for their 30th Anniversary with a handful of fan club shows at the Fillmore in San Francisco.
At what a sweet deal it was! Metallica fan-club members could see shows for $6, or all four for $19.81 ( in honor of the 30 year mark).
All four show were recorded for posterity, and now the first show is available to MetClub fans.
The December 5 show kicked off the first of four nights with a bunch of special guests, including former Metallica bassist Jason Newsted, John Marshall (Metal Church), Sean Harris and Brian Tatler (Diamond Head), Biff Byford (Saxon) and Apocalyptica.
The full 22-song set from Night 1 can be downloaded at LiveMetallica.com, and is available in MP3 for $9.95, FLAC/ALAC for $12.95, or individual tracks for $0.99 each.
